The Standard Organisation of Nigeria, SON and other concerned agencies have been charged to wake up to their responsibilities of ensuring quality standard in the circulation of gas materials, to reduce incidence of gas explosion, which is fast turning into a daily occurrence in Ogun State.

A community leader, Chief Toyin Amuzu, TA, who stated this in Abeokuta, while reacting to the recent explosion at the Obasanjo Presidential Library, advised Ogun residents to always take extra precautions while purchasing anything that has to do with gas.

Chief Amuzu said with this fourth explosion recorded in Abeokuta, barely 48 hours after the gas explosion in Conference Hotel, it is likely that the gas in circulation are either substandard or expired.

He therefore, called on government agencies, technicians and professionals to quickly put heads together and devise means of forestalling such occurrences.

According to him, “our people, especially regular users of such gas products should be wary of purchasing fake, adulterated or expired gas. The cause could be adulterated oxyacetylene gas in circulation thus gas consumers should be more conscious”.

“People should also avoid gathering in places where such materials are used”, he said.

Chief Toyin Amuzu, said by now, any responsible Government should be concerned about saving people’s lives by putting in place measures that will check such occurrences.

He commiserated with the families of those affected by the gas explosions.
